Chunqi Wang is a scholar working on Biomedical Engineering, Aerospace Engineering and Electrical and Electronic Engineering. According to data from OpenAlex, Chunqi Wang has authored 52 papers receiving a total of 990 indexed citations (citations by other indexed papers that have themselves been cited), including 28 papers in Biomedical Engineering, 12 papers in Aerospace Engineering and 10 papers in Electrical and Electronic Engineering. Recurrent topics in Chunqi Wang’s work include Acoustic Wave Phenomena Research (25 papers), Aerodynamics and Acoustics in Jet Flows (7 papers) and Spectroscopy and Chemometric Analyses (6 papers). Chunqi Wang is often cited by papers focused on Acoustic Wave Phenomena Research (25 papers), Aerodynamics and Acoustics in Jet Flows (7 papers) and Spectroscopy and Chemometric Analyses (6 papers). Chunqi Wang collaborates with scholars based in China, Hong Kong and United Kingdom. Chunqi Wang's co-authors include Lixi Huang, Yumin Zhang, Cheng Li, Jie Pan, Xiang Liu, Xiang Liu, Jinming Liu, Jingcheng Zeng, Zuojuan Du and Jiayu Xiao and has published in prestigious journals such as Applied Physics Letters, Cancer Research and Journal of Hazardous Materials.
